1. Labubu Toy Clicker

The Labubu toy has taken social media by storm, and this game captures that energy perfectly. Tap along to meme-worthy beats while Labubu bounces and dances in increasingly ridiculous ways. The rhythm mechanics are tighter than you'd expect — it's genuinely fun even if you've never heard of Labubu before. Collectible outfits and unlockable songs keep the progression loop going well beyond the opening minutes.

2. Cat Farm — Meme Music

Imagine a farm where every single resident is a cat playing invisible bongo. That's Cat Farm. You collect new kittens, each paired with their own meme track, and arrange them into increasingly chaotic musical orchestras. The game somehow manages to be both soothing and completely unhinged simultaneously. Perfect for anyone who considers "nyan cat" a legitimate music genre.

3. Meme Crusher

This one is exactly what it sounds like: you crush memes. Popular internet images fly across the screen and your job is to smash them into satisfying pixel dust before they escape. Difficulty ramps up fast — by level five you're dealing with waves of Distracted Boyfriend, Woman Yelling at Cat, and Drake memes all at once. Surprisingly therapeutic.

4. Grow a Meme: Original

One of the most creative entries on this list. You start with a blank meme face and a bare room, then customize everything from expressions to wallpaper to caption style. Once your meme is built, you take it into battle arenas against other players' creations. The combat is simple but the character-building depth is genuinely impressive. Your meme, your rules.

5. Meme Dance! Tralalero, Pomni, Pedro, Rat, Beast!

Five of the internet's most beloved characters in one rhythm game — Tralalero Tralala (the Italian shark in sneakers), Pomni from The Amazing Digital Circus, Pedro the raccoon, and two more chaos agents. Each level uses their iconic sounds as the foundation for rhythm challenges. It's an absolute festival of noise and that's precisely the point. Hit the beats, unlock new characters, repeat forever.

6. Brainrot Case Simulator

If you've spent any time on TikTok in the past year, you know what Brainrot animals are. This game lets you spin cases to collect them — from Bombardiro Crocodilo to Tralalero — each with their own signature sound and rarity tier. The gacha loop is perfectly calibrated: rare drops feel genuinely exciting, and common ones are still entertaining enough to justify every spin. A must-play for Italian meme fans.

7. Save Memes 3D

Memland is under attack by evil memes, and only you can stop it. This 3D adventure wraps its humor around a surprisingly competent action framework. You'll battle corrupted versions of classic meme formats, collect power-ups shaped like reaction images, and encounter boss fights that are both challenging and hilarious. The writing alone is worth the playthrough — whoever scripted this understood the brief completely.

8. Brawl Memes 2

Think Brawl Stars, but every character is replaced by an internet meme fighter. Open boxes to unlock new roster additions, then take them into Showdown, Gems Grab, and other familiar modes. Each meme fighter has abilities that directly reference their original internet context — the designs are creative and often very funny. Competitive enough for ranked players, silly enough for casual afternoon sessions.

Tips for New Players — Getting the Most from Meme Games

If this is your first time exploring лучшие Meme games online, a few things will help:

Start with what you already know. If you've been living on Brainrot content, jump straight to Brainrot Case Simulator or Brainrot Hits. If Pedro and Pomni are your people, start with Meme Dance or Meme Music. Familiarity with the characters makes the games funnier and the references land harder.

Don't underestimate the rhythm games. A lot of players assume they'll be too easy. They're not. Games like Meme Dance! and Meme Rhythm Clicker scale their difficulty fast — by the upper levels, you actually need to concentrate.

Idle clickers reward patience. LOL Rockets and Labubu Toy Clicker both have idle mechanics that pay off when you return. Start a session, upgrade everything you can, then let the game run in a background tab. Come back to a pile of resources and a stronger roster.

Merge games have real strategy. Mix Banana Cat Meme and Meme Battle: Monster Merge aren't pure tap-to-win — merge order and positioning matter. Spend a minute understanding the mechanics before going full chaos mode, or you'll hit a wall earlier than necessary.

Guess the Meme is perfect for group play. Get a couple of friends around one screen, hit play, and race to name the meme before anyone else. The competitive format makes it immediately more entertaining than going solo.
